Let’s explore some creative options that can transform your space.Glass Splashbacks for a Contemporary LookGlass splashbacks are a popular choice for modern kitchens. They can be customized in various colors and textures, offering a sleek and clean appearance. Plus, the reflective surface can help make your kitchen feel more spacious. Imagine cooking with an unobstructed view through a beautifully designed glass splashback!Tile Patterns that PopIf you're a fan of classic designs, consider using tiles for your splashback. Mosaic or patterned tiles can create a focal point that draws the eye. You can mix and match colors to create a unique design that complements your kitchen decor. What’s better than cooking in a space that feels vibrant and alive?Metallic Finishes for a Touch of GlamFor those who love a bit of bling, metallic finishes can be a stunning choice. Copper, brass, or stainless steel splashbacks can add a touch of glam to your kitchen while being easy to clean. They also reflect light beautifully, enhancing the overall ambiance of the space.Wood Accents for a Rustic VibeWooden splashbacks can introduce warmth and texture to your kitchen. Consider using reclaimed wood for a rustic look or treated wood for a more polished finish. This option is perfect for farmhouse-style kitchens, creating a cozy and inviting atmosphere.Artwork Splashbacks for Personal TouchWhy not turn your splashback into a piece of art? You can use printed glass or tiles featuring your favorite artwork or photography. It’s a fantastic way to express your personality and make your kitchen truly unique.FAQWhat are the best materials for a kitchen splashback?Common materials include glass, tiles, stainless steel, and acrylic. Each offers unique benefits in terms of style and maintenance.How do I clean and maintain my splashback?Most splashbacks can be easily cleaned with warm soapy water.
